Thai Potsticker Coconut Soup

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 1 red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 medium sweet potato, chopped
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ons red curry paste
  • Juice of 1 lime
  • 14 oz can unsweetened coconut milk
  • 4 cups vegetable stock
  • 13 oz package potstickers (vegetarian or meat-filled)
  • Fresh cilantro for garnish


Instructions

  1. In a large stockpot,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Sauté garlic, onion, red bell pepper, and sweet potato for about 3–4 minutes until softened.
  2. Stir in red curry paste and cook for another minute. Add coconut milk and vegetable stock; whisk until smooth.
  3. Bring to a boil, then add potstickers. Reduce heat to simmer and cook for 6–8 minutes until slightly thickened.
  4. Stir in spinach and lime juice; cook for an additional minute until spinach wilts.
  5. Serve hot, garnished with fresh cilantro.
